Wall adapter makes squeaking noises

Alright I know this sounds weird and you probably think I'm crazy but here we go. My wall adapter for my charger makes squeaking noises. Imagine a cricket got trapped inside it somehow. That's what it sounds like. Its kind of quiet but definitely noticeable. If I unplug my phone from the adapter or unplug the adapter from the wall, it instantly stops. I'm using the stock Motorola charger and micro USB cable. Should I be worried?

If it is just a high pitched whine, its probably ok. But if it is sporatic chirping there may be as short in the transformer and that is not safe.

If your into fixing those kinds of things yourself, like I am, and don't mind cracking it open, check the capacitors inside your charger. Electrolytic capacitors are prone to failure. My power adapter for my XM Radio did the same thing, when I opened it up the capacitors had burst and were leaking. It's a cheap fix.

this does not look good, that to me looks for sure like the cable is burning.
Have you tried touching cable while charging? Is it getting hot?
Another thing to check is, is the area of discolourasion either really soft or really hard in comparison the the "normal" part of the cable or a new cable?
If so then I'd strongly suggest getting a new cable and never using the cable again, cause if it is faulty, there is a chance of fire.
All Assuming of course it actually is faulty.
